Peter Wilson
@peterwilsoncc on WordPress.org and Slack
- Member Since: November 2nd, 2008
- Location: Melbourne, Australia
- Website: peterwilson.cc
- GitHub: peterwilsoncc
- Job Title: Lead Engineer
- Employer: 10up
Bio
Contributions Sponsored
Contribution History
Peter Wilson’s badges:- Core Contributor
- Core Performance Contributor
- Core Team
- Meta Contributor
- Plugin Developer
- Security Contributor
- Security Team
- Theme Developer
- Translation Contributor
- WordCamp Organizer
- WordCamp Speaker
- WordPress.tv Contributor
-
Reopened ticket #57375 on Core Trac:
Add move_dir() function -
Committed [55226] to Core SVN:
Filesystem API: Prevent fatal error in `move_dir()`. Correctly ... -
Closed pull request #3631 on WordPress/wordpress-develop:
Support additional link related pseudo classes in theme.json -
Mentioned in [55220] on Core SVN:
Upgrade/Install: Use `move_dir()` instead of `copy_dir()` in `WP_Upgrader::install_package()` when possible. -
Closed pull request #3505 on WordPress/wordpress-develop:
Add unit tests for _truncate_post_slug -
Closed ticket #56868 on Core Trac:
Add test coverage for _truncate_post_slug -
Committed [55208] to Core SVN:
Posts, Post Types: Add test coverage for `_truncate_post_slug()`. ... -
Closed pull request #3954 on WordPress/wordpress-develop:
Deprecate get_page_by_title(). -
Closed ticket #57041 on Core Trac:
Deprecate `get_page_by_title()` in favour of `WP_Query` -
Committed [55207] to Core SVN:
Posts, Post Types: Deprecate `get_page_by_title()` in favour of ... -
Mentioned in [55204] on Core SVN:
Filesystem API: Add directory support to `WP_Filesystem_Direct::move()`. -
Mentioned in [55203] on Core SVN:
Introduce HTML API with HTML Tag Processor -
Created issue #47717 in the WordPress/gutenberg repository:
Account for Embed templates in Site Editing -
Mentioned in [55188] on Core SVN:
Themes: Increase HTTP timeout for Theme API requests. -
Mentioned in [55186] on Core SVN:
Emoji: Always skip nodes with the `wp-exclude-emoji` CSS class. -
Submitted pull request #3954 to WordPress/wordpress-develop:
Deprecate get_page_by_title(). -
Mentioned in [55171] on Core SVN:
Media: Allow to omit `decoding="async"` on tags from `wp_get_attachment_image()`. -
Mentioned in [55169] on Core SVN:
Query: Use `WP_Query` in `get_page_by_path`. -
Mentioned in [55164] on Core SVN:
Users: Add context to the `send_auth_cookies` filter. -
Closed pull request #3133 on WordPress/wordpress-develop:
Alternate approach: Guard `wp_strip_all_tags()` against non-string values. -
Reopened ticket #39710 on Core Trac:
Deprecate unused `WP_Media_List_Table::column_desc()` -
Mentioned in [55150] on Core SVN:
Build/Test Tools: Update PostCSS to version 8. -
Submitted pull request #3924 to WordPress/wordpress-develop:
Extend wp.org api request timeouts. -
Closed pull request #1109 on WordPress/wordpress-develop:
Allow unsecure connection for the local environment -
Submitted pull request #3912 to WordPress/wordpress-develop:
Allow insecure HTTP connection for the local environment -
Submitted pull request #3910 to WordPress/wordpress-develop:
Remove unused wp-nux css dependencies. -
Closed pull request #3897 on WordPress/wordpress-develop:
Use filesystem classes for move_dir(). -
Mentioned in [55121] on Core SVN:
Themes: Support additional link related pseudo classes in `theme.json`. -
Submitted pull request #3897 to WordPress/wordpress-develop:
Use filesystem classes for move_dir(). -
Closed ticket #57520 on Core Trac:
Archive pages should be noindex -
Submitted pull request #3875 to WordPress/wordpress-develop:
Pwcc/testing a thing -
Closed ticket #57241 on Core Trac:
PHP 8.x and PHPMailer error -
Mentioned in [55085] on Core SVN:
Posts, Post Types: Use persistent caching in `get_adjacent_post` function. -
Mentioned in [55083] on Core SVN:
Taxonomy: Remove placeholder from `WP_Term_Query` cache key. -
Closed ticket #57462 on Core Trac:
wp super cache is failure -
Mentioned in [55068] on Core SVN:
Embeds: Update Mixcloud oEmbed URL to the new domain. -
Mentioned in [55061] on Core SVN:
Bundled Themes: Add Mastodon domains for menu item icons. -
Mentioned in [55059] on Core SVN:
Menus: Compare `$menu_item->ID` and `$menu_item->menu_item_parent` as strings and avoid moidifying them. -
Mentioned in [55055] on Core SVN:
Upgrade/Install: Revert a temporary conditional for testing the Rollbacks feature project. -
Mentioned in [55048] on Core SVN:
General: revert [55045]. -
Mentioned in [55035] on Core SVN:
Query: Stop priming posts twice in `WP_Query`. -
Submitted pull request #3821 to WordPress/wordpress-develop:
Date querystring parameter is not being sanitized correctly -
Submitted pull request #3820 to WordPress/wordpress-develop:
Coding Standards: mark warnings that trigger CI failures as errors. -
Created ticket #57426 on Core Trac:
Coding Standards: mark warnings that trigger CI failures as errors. -
Submitted pull request #3816 to WordPress/wordpress-develop:
list authors -
Closed ticket #57386 on Core Trac:
Add filter to WP_Upgrader::install_package for copy_dir() -
Closed ticket #57324 on Core Trac:
Update jQuery v3.6.1 to v3.6.3 -
Committed [55012] to Core SVN:
External Libraries: Update jQuery to 3.6.3. Update the jQuery library ... -
Submitted pull request #3792 to WordPress/wordpress-develop:
Just the tests. -
Mentioned in [55007] on Core SVN:
HTTP API: Adds BC-layer `/library/Requests.php` file.
Developer
-
Hello Hamilton
Active Installs: Less than 10
-
Rapid Canonical URLs
Active Installs: 100+
-
Rapid Twitter Widget
Active Installs: 200+
Contributor
-
Ads.txt Manager
Active Installs: 100,000+
-
Comment Moderation Role by WPBeginner
Active Installs: 300+
-
Missed Scheduled Posts Publisher by WPBeginner
Active Installs: 10,000+
Support Rep
-
Ad Refresh Control
Active Installs: 200+
-
Autoshare for Twitter
Active Installs: 100+
-
Block for Apple Maps
Active Installs: 800+
-
Convert to Blocks
Active Installs: 400+
-
Debug Bar for Sophi
Active Installs: Less than 10
-
Eight Day Week Print Workflow
Active Installs: 10+
-
Insecure Content Warning
Active Installs: 10+
-
Insert Special Characters
Active Installs: 3,000+
-
Publisher Media Kit
Active Installs: 100+
-
Restricted Site Access
Active Installs: 20,000+
-
Retro Winamp Block
Active Installs: 100+
-
Safe Redirect Manager
Active Installs: 50,000+
-
Safe SVG
Active Installs: 700,000+
-
Simple Local Avatars
Active Installs: 100,000+
-
Simple Page Ordering
Active Installs: 200,000+
-
Simple Podcasting
Active Installs: 300+
-
Sophi
Active Installs: Less than 10
-
Big Red FrameworkActive Installs: Less than 10